Understanding Wheel Cylinders for Drum Brakes


Drum brakes are a crucial safety component in many vehicles, especially older models and some current light trucks. One of the key elements in the operation of drum brakes is the wheel cylinder. This article will explore the role of wheel cylinders, their functioning, and maintenance considerations, all of which are essential for ensuring effective braking performance.


What is a Wheel Cylinder?


A wheel cylinder is a hydraulic component found in drum brake systems. Its primary function is to convert hydraulic pressure from the brake line into mechanical force that pushes the brake shoes against the inner surface of the brake drum. This action creates the necessary friction to slow down or stop the vehicle.


The design of a wheel cylinder typically consists of a cylindrical metal casing with two pistons inside, one for each brake shoe. When the driver presses the brake pedal, brake fluid under pressure flows into the wheel cylinder. This pressure causes the pistons to move outward, forcing the brake shoes against the drum. The more pressure applied to the brake pedal, the harder the shoes press against the drum, leading to greater stopping power.


How Wheel Cylinders Work


The operation of a wheel cylinder is relatively straightforward but critical for effective braking. Here’s a step-by-step explanation of how it works


1. Brake Pedal Engagement When the driver presses the brake pedal, it activates the master cylinder, which pumps brake fluid through the hydraulic system.


2. Pressure Build-Up The fluid flows through the brake lines and reaches the wheel cylinder situated at each wheel.


3. Piston Movement The hydraulic pressure forces the pistons within the wheel cylinder to move outward. Since there are usually two pistons (one for each brake shoe), both move simultaneously.


4. Brake Shoe Engagement As the pistons move outward, they push the brake shoes against the brake drum. The friction generated between the shoes and the drum initiates the braking process.


5. Braking and Release Once the driver releases the brake pedal, the pressure in the wheel cylinder decreases, allowing the pistons to retract and the brake shoes to separate from the drum. This action allows the vehicle to resume wheel rotation.


Common Issues with Wheel Cylinders

While wheel cylinders are designed to be durable, various issues can arise that may affect their performance. Common problems include


- Leaking Over time, seals within the wheel cylinder can wear out or become damaged, leading to brake fluid leaks. This can cause a loss of hydraulic pressure, resulting in poor braking performance.


- Corrosion Moisture in the brake fluid or exposure to road salt can lead to corrosion within the wheel cylinder. This corrosion can interfere with the movement of the pistons and may cause them to seize.


- Contamination If dirt, debris, or contaminated brake fluid enters the wheel cylinder, it can damage the seals and pistons, leading to premature wear or failure.


Maintenance Tips


To keep wheel cylinders in good working order and to ensure safe braking, routine maintenance is essential. Here are a few tips for vehicle owners


- Check for Leaks Regularly inspect for signs of brake fluid leakage around the wheel cylinders. If you notice any fluid on the brake components or the ground, it's vital to have the system inspected immediately.


- Flush Brake Fluid Brake fluid should be flushed and replaced according to your vehicle's maintenance schedule, typically every 1-2 years. Fresh fluid helps prevent corrosion and contamination.


- Inspect Brake Components During tire rotations or regular maintenance checks, ask a qualified mechanic to inspect the brake system, including the wheel cylinders.


- Replace Worn Components If the wheel cylinder is found to be leaking or malfunctioning, it should be replaced promptly, along with any other affected brake components.
